Ensuring Accuracy in Patient Identification During Blood Sample Collection

Introduction

Accurate patient identification is essential in the medical laboratory setting to ensure that Test Results are correctly matched with the correct individual. Errors in patient identification can lead to misdiagnosis, inappropriate treatment, and compromised patient safety. Procedures for Ensuring Accuracy of Patient Identification

1. Use of Two Forms of Patient Identification

One of the most effective ways to ensure accurate patient identification is to use two forms of patient identification before collecting a blood sample. This can help minimize the risk of errors and enhance patient safety. The two forms of identification typically used include:

  1. Full Name: The patient's full name should be matched with the information on their ID band or requisition form.
  2. Date of Birth: Verifying the patient's date of birth is another common method of ensuring accurate identification.

2. Verification of Patient Information

Before collecting a blood sample, it is essential to verify the patient's information, including their full name, date of birth, and any other relevant identifying details. This verification should be done by comparing the information provided by the patient with the information on their ID band or requisition form. Any Discrepancies should be resolved before proceeding with the sample collection.

3. Adherence to Standard Protocols

Medical laboratory professionals should adhere to established protocols and procedures for patient identification to minimize the risk of errors. This may include:

  1. Using barcode scanning technology to ensure accurate matching of samples with patient information
  2. Double-checking patient information before taking a blood sample
  3. Verifying the identity of the patient with a witness, if necessary

4. Proper Labeling of Samples

After collecting a blood sample, it is crucial to label the sample accurately with the patient's information, including their full name, date of birth, and any other required identifiers. Proper labeling helps ensure that the sample is correctly matched with the patient and that the Test Results are accurately reported.

5. Reporting and Resolving Errors

In the event of a patient identification error, it is essential to report the error immediately to the appropriate personnel and take steps to resolve the issue. This may include collecting a new sample, re-verifying the patient's information, and updating the laboratory records accordingly.
